Kids these days just too spoiled. They're living in a material-rich world, even just compared to a generation of kids before them. I don't remember my dad buy me a computer when I was a kid; he got the toy for himself and I just looking over his shoulder saying "please, please".
Heh, the good old days. I still remembered that one summer when I came back home with mom and my brother after spending the summer visiting relatives in Canada and the US. A strange looking boxes with TV sitting in the living room. It's called a "computer". (See here, a OSI C8P DF)
Being a kid, of course I told my friends in school about it. And of course, they don't belived me. It's way back then (the early 80's) when a computer is a gadget only live in anime and TV shows. But there is one sitting in our living room, how strange....
Anyway, kids these days must be watching too much Court drama (Ally McBeal maybe??) on TV.

10/10: Podcasting
So, this is the latest from the worldwide 2-way web.
Podcasting basically uses RSS to publish multimedia bits. The RSS feed contains a "enclosure" that point to a audio track, one can download it later (ie overnight) for listening. Currently it is for audio blogging, your own radio/talk show kind of thing. The original idea is for iPod and other mp3 players, but I'm sure it will be much more in the future.
iPodder is the application that people put together to do podcasting.
